Using Shockwave Lithotripsy to Treat Severe Calcified Mitral Stenosis in a Pregnant Woman
ABSTRACT Rheumatic mitral stenosis (MS) with significant calcification presents challenges for both surgical and transcatheter interventions. Percutaneous balloon mitral valvuloplasty (PBMV) is often limited in these cases due to valve rigidity, increasing the risk of mitral regurgitation (MR).
